* `AFL_FRIDA_INST_UNSTABLE_COVERAGE_FILE` - File to write DynamoRIO format
coverage information for unstable edges (e.g., to be loaded within IDA
lighthouse).
+* `AFL_FRIDA_JS_SCRIPT` - Set the script to be loaded by the FRIDA scripting
+ engine. See [Scipting.md](Scripting.md) for details.
* `AFL_FRIDA_OUTPUT_STDOUT` - Redirect the standard output of the target
application to the named file (supersedes the setting of `AFL_DEBUG_CHILD`).
* `AFL_FRIDA_OUTPUT_STDERR` - Redirect the standard error of the target

+#!/usr/bin/python3
+import argparse
+from elftools.elf.elffile import ELFFile
+
+def process_file(file, symbol, base):
+ with open(file, 'rb') as f:
+ elf = ELFFile(f)
+ symtab = elf.get_section_by_name('.symtab')
+ mains = symtab.get_symbol_by_name(symbol)
+ if len(mains) != 1:
+ print ("Failed to find main")
+ return 1
+
+ main_addr = mains[0]['st_value']
+ main = base + main_addr
+ print ("0x%016x" % main)
+ return 0
+
+def hex_value(x):
+ return int(x, 16)
+
+def main():
+ parser = argparse.ArgumentParser(description='Process some integers.')
+ parser.add_argument('-f', '--file', dest='file', type=str,
+ help='elf file name', required=True)
+ parser.add_argument('-s', '--symbol', dest='symbol', type=str,
+ help='symbol name', required=True)
+ parser.add_argument('-b', '--base', dest='base', type=hex_value,
+ help='elf base address', required=True)
+
+ args = parser.parse_args()
+ return process_file (args.file, args.symbol, args.base)
+
+if __name__ == "__main__":
+ ret = main()
+ exit(ret)
